Stain Shade Repurposes Surplus Materials For Manhattan Portage Capsule
A release born out of a long-term admiration for the New York bag aficionados.














After dressing vintage Nike pieces for a recent summer capsule, London-based Stain Shade returns this season with a unique selection of Manhattan Portage bags.
The creative studio — who towards the end of last year dropped a duo of bespoke chairs — has been a long-term admirer of Manhattan Portage as a stalwart of the New York bike courier scene, appreciating its consistency in crafting durable bags fit for purpose.
Now, creating similar bags of its own, Stain Shade releases its latest capsule which has been made using hundreds of metres of hand-dyed fabric sent from the Manhattan Portage factory. Offering a plethora of unique styles and looks, the capsule finds the balance between Manhattan Portages’ penchant for durability and Stain Shade’s eye for style.
Set to drop on August 9, the Stain Shade x Manhattan Portage capsule will be available from the likes of Browns and 18montrose.
